The car is great, but the engine started whining at about 90k. The mechanic I use can't figure it out. It seems to come from near the belts. Just a steady whine that increases and decreases with RPM's. Any help would be appreciated at kevin.anglim@UBSpainewebber.com
Have the timing chains checked. This is an interference engine. When the chain goes so does the engine. It's a common Q45 problem.

I have a '90 that developed this sound 4 months ago. Found an Infiniti specialty shop in Atlanta that pointed me to the set of pulleys on the front of the engine. $100 and sound gone!
